Check for primality with a regexp
http://montreal.pm.org/tech/neil_kandalgaonkar.shtml
1 2 class Fixnum 3 def prime? 4 ('1' * self) !~ /^1?$|^(11+?)\1+$/ 5 end 6 end
DZone Snippets > ciconia > regexp
13463 users tagging and storing useful source code snippets
Snippets is a public source code repository. Easily build up your personal collection of code snippets, categorize them with tags / keywords, and share them with the world
Sharon Rosner http://hiperu.blogspot.com
1 2 class Fixnum 3 def prime? 4 ('1' * self) !~ /^1?$|^(11+?)\1+$/ 5 end 6 end